Order by Deputy High Court Judge K.W. Lung:

Leave to apply for Judicial Review be dismissed.

Observations for the Applicant:

1.The applicant is an illegal immigrant by staying in Hong Kong without permission and he lodged a non-refoulement claim with the Director of Immigration (“the Director”). The Director rejected his application and he appealed to the Torture Claims Appeal Board (“the Board”). Having considered his evidence, the Board, by its Decision (“the Board’s Decision”), rejected his appeal and affirmed the Director’s Decision.

2.The applicant filed Form 86 on 24 August 2020 to apply for leave to apply for judicial review of the Board’s Decision.

3.By affirmation filed on 23 May 2023, the applicant said that he wants to withdraw his leave application as his problem in his country has been solved.

4.In accordance with the Court of Appeal in Re Manik Md Mahamudun Nabi [2022] HKCA 471 at §19:

“(1) The applicant on his own motion applied to the Court to withdraw his application for leave to apply for judicial review. The Judge acceded to his application, whereupon there was nothing outstanding in the action. The Judge was correct to conclude the action by ordering a dismissal of the application instead of leaving the action at large.”

5.The application is therefore dismissed.
